In fair ranked link prediction, demographic parity ($Δ_\mathrm{DP}$) is a common fairness metric. Yet, Mattos et al. (2025) argue that it fails to detect exposure bias because it ignores where links appear in the ranking. In this study, we reproduce this claim by showing that…
